Obituary for Ronald P Gouldner

Ronald P Gouldner, 71, of Reading Pa, went peacefully home to be with Jesus Sunday morning, July 17th.  

Born in Schuylkill County, PA he was the son of Viola Moyer and Paul Adam Gouldner.

Ron was a proud Marine having served in Vietnam from 1968-1975 with the 3rd Recon Battalion.  He was a parachutist constantly being deployed (with his team of 5 other men) by helicopter deep inside NVA held territory on intel gathering missions.  These missions lasted 5-6 days with a 2-day break to restock and go over intel for the next mission.  Ron was an outstanding Recon Marine and a valuable team member who could always be counted on to carry out more than his fair share of duties.  He was awarded with a Vietnam Service Medal, Campaign Medal, Cross of Gallantry, National Defense Service Medal, Combat Action Ribbon and Parachutist Insignia.

Ron worked many years at Reazor Custom Woodworking making cabinetry in Reading, Pa.  It was a job he truly loved, but the progression of his Parkinson’s disease forced him to retire early.

He loved eating burgers at the Café Waldorf in Reading, chatting and hanging out with his good friends there.

Ron attended Glad Tidings Church in West Lawn with friends and other veterans.  That is where he met his Savior that truly changed his life.  It was a sermon series in January 2019 called “Reset”.  He said I need to do a reset of my life and prayed that day.

He was also an active attendee at Veterans Making a Difference…a veteran center in Reading with a mission of veterans helping other veterans.  He made many close friends there.
